Unifrax I LLC is a leading producer of high temperature insulation products for a wide variety of industrial thermal management applications. Since 1942, Unifrax high temperature insulation products have been providing heat management solutions in a wide range of markets. Consider their Fiberfrax ceramic fiber product line, revolutionary Insulfrax , and Isofrax alkaline earth silicate fiber products, and their other high performance high temperature insulation products. Their commitment to the high temperature insulation market is evident, with over 50 product forms, including bulk fiber, blankets, boards, modules, papers and felts, woven textiles, ropes and braids, coatings and mixes, and accessory products. Unifrax fiber products are used to solve application problems in the ferrous and non-ferrous metals, industrial chemicals, petroleum products, power generation, ceramic, glass, automotive, fire protection, aerospace, appliance and other industries.
